在数字化浪潮中,一个高效、用户友好且能被搜索引擎“读懂”的网站,是企业或个人在互联网竞争中脱颖而出的关键。本文将以PHP语言为核心,深入解析如何通过技术手段与SEO(搜索引擎优化)策略结合,打造兼具功能性与可见性的网站。

一、PHP与SEO:技术基石与流量引擎的结合

PHP作为一种服务器端脚本语言,其动态生成内容的能力是网站功能实现的核心。而SEO则是通过优化技术,让搜索引擎更高效地抓取、理解并推荐网站内容。两者的结合,既能保障用户体验,又能提升自然流量。

1. 动态内容与SEO的兼容性

PHP通过数据库交互动态生成网页内容,例如电商网站的商品列表或新闻站的实时资讯。但动态内容若处理不当,可能导致搜索引擎难以解析。解决方法是:

  • URL语义化:将动态参数转化为可读路径。例如,用`/news/php-seo-guide`替代`/index.php?id=123`,使URL包含关键词,提升搜索引擎对页面主题的理解。
  • 静态化处理:通过缓存技术(如生成HTML静态文件)减少服务器负载,同时提高页面加载速度——这是Google排名算法的重要指标。
  • 2. 元数据管理:让搜索引擎“一目了然”

    PHP可动态设置页面的``(标题标签)和`<meta description>`(标签)。例如,针对不同产品页面,自动生成包含关键词的标题:</p> <p>php</p> <p><title><?php echo $productName; ?></p> <li>最佳价格与性能评测 | 品牌名

    标题长度需控制在60字符以内,不超过160字符,避免关键信息被截断。

    二、PHP技术栈的SEO优化实践

    1. 网站性能优化:速度即用户体验

  • 代码层面
  • 使用OPcache预编译PHP脚本,减少解释执行时间。
  • 压缩CSS/JS文件,延迟加载非首屏图片(通过`loading="lazy"`属性)。
  • 服务器层面
  • 选择CDN加速静态资源分发,减少全球用户的访问延迟。
  • 启用GZIP压缩,降低数据传输量。
  • 2. 结构化数据:增强内容可读性

    通过PHP生成JSON-LD格式的结构化数据,帮助搜索引擎理解页面内容。例如,商品页可嵌入以下代码:

    php

    这能触发要求的富媒体展示(如星级评分、价格区间),提升点击率。

    3. 内部链接策略:构建内容网络

    PHP可自动化生成内部链接,例如在文章底部推荐相关主题内容:

    php

    $relatedPosts = get_related_posts($currentPostId);

    foreach ($relatedPosts as $post) {

    echo '' . $post['title'] . '';

    内部链接需使用性锚文本(如“PHP性能优化技巧”而非“点击这里”),帮助搜索引擎建立内容关联性。

    三、PHP开发中的SEO陷阱与规避方案

    PHP学习方向解析:选PHP还是其他编程语言_关键对比与前景展望

    1. 重复内容问题

    动态参数可能生成多个URL指向相同内容(如`?sort=price`和`?sort=rating`)。解决方案:

  • Canonical标签:在页面头部声明主版本URL:
  • php

  • Robots.txt规则:禁止爬虫抓取无关参数路径。
  • 2. 移动端适配不足

    PHP学习方向解析:选PHP还是其他编程语言_关键对比与前景展望

    Google采用“移动优先索引”,若移动端体验差,直接影响排名。PHP开发者需:

  • 使用响应式设计框架(如Bootstrap),确保布局自适应不同屏幕。
  • 单独检测移动设备,提供精简版内容(如缩短导航菜单)。
  • 四、未来趋势:PHP与AI驱动的SEO革新

    1. AI内容生成与人工审核的平衡

    利用PHP集成AI工具(如ChatGPT)批量生成产品或博客草稿,但需人工添加独家案例与数据,避免内容同质化。页面底部可标注“本文由AI辅助创作,专家审核发布”,符合搜索引擎对E-E-A-T(专业性、权威性)的要求。

    2. 语音搜索优化

    随着语音助手普及,用户倾向于用自然语言搜索(如“附近提供PHP培训的机构”)。PHP开发者需:

  • 在FAQ页面中嵌入问答内容,并使用`FAQ Schema`标记。
  • 优化长尾关键词,如“如何用PHP解决SEO重复内容问题”。
  • 五、技术为骨,策略为魂

    PHP为SEO提供了强大的技术实现能力,但成功的关键在于持续优化与适应算法变化。从代码层的性能调优,到内容层的语义化设计,再到未来AI与语音搜索的布局,开发者需以用户需求为核心,构建搜索引擎与访客“双赢”的网站生态。

    通过上述策略,PHP不仅是一个功能实现的工具,更将成为驱动网站在搜索引擎中持续攀升的引擎。